Technical Problem

Existing free address seating systems do not effectively manage seat usage, allowing employees to occupy multiple seats, leading to inefficiencies and user inconvenience.

Method used

A seat reservation system that includes a processing unit to generate images showing seat availability, a communication unit to transmit data, and a storage unit to associate user information with seat usage times, enforcing seat use and reservation limits to optimize seat utilization.

Benefits of technology

The system enables effective seat management, improving user convenience by ensuring fair and efficient use of available seats while preventing over-occupancy.

Abstract

To effectively utilize seats, while improving the convenience for users.SOLUTION: In a seat reservation system 100, a communication unit 15 transmits image data generated in a processing unit 14 to a user terminal 2, and receives multiple pieces of information related to the start of seat use procedures and the start of seat reservation procedures of a user, from the user terminal 2 that displays a reservation reception screen. The processing unit 14 generates, when the total number of seats of the number of seats occupied by the user stored in a storage unit 17 and the number of seats reserved by the user is equal to or less than an allowable number of seats, image data for an input image for receiving an input by a user to proceed with the seat use procedures or the seat reservation procedures, and causes the communication unit 15 to transmit the image data to the user terminal 2. The processing unit 14 generates, when the total number of seats is greater than the allowable number of seats, image data of a notification image for notifying the user of non-permission to continue the seat use procedures or the seat reservation procedures, and causes the communication unit 15 to transmit the image data to the user terminal 2.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 1

[0002] Patent Document 1 discloses a free address seating map providing system. The free address seating map providing system disclosed in Patent Document 1 is a system that provides a real-time seating map corresponding to the free addresses of office seats. The free address seating map providing system includes an acquisition means, an identification means, a display means, a reception means, and a provision means. The acquisition means acquires identification information provided for office seats from a user terminal. The identification means identifies a seat ID linked to the acquired identification information. The display means displays a declaration page on the user terminal, linked to the identified seat, which allows the user to declare that they are sitting in the seat. The reception means accepts the declaration from the declaration page. The provision means provides the seat map displayed in association with the user sitting in the declared seat. [Prior art documents] [Patent documents]

[0003] [Patent Document 1] International Publication No. 2020 / 079821 Summary of the Invention [Problem to be solved by the invention]

[0004] The free address seating map providing system disclosed in Patent Document 1 makes it easy to know who is sitting where in real time. However, in a free address office, employees who use seats may wish to use multiple seats.

[0005] An object of the present disclosure is to provide a seat reservation system, a seat reservation method, and a program that enable effective use of seats while improving user convenience. [Means for solving the problem]

[0013] (1) Seat reservation system The seat reservation system 100 (see FIG. 1) is a system used to reserve multiple seats in an office, such as a free address office.

[0014] A free address office is an office where individual seats are not assigned to multiple users, and each user can reserve and use an available seat. In this embodiment, the free address office is, for example, an office with multiple seats that can be reserved by multiple users. The multiple seats can be used without a reservation. The multiple users include, for example, multiple employees working in the free address office. The free address office may also have a conference space that can be reserved by users. The conference space may have, for example, three or more seats arranged around one large table. The office is not limited to an office on one floor where users work at a company's headquarters or branch office, but may also be an office on another floor or a satellite office.

[0015] The seat reservation system 100 includes a plurality of user terminals 2 corresponding one-to-one to a plurality of users. Application software for using the seat reservation system 100 is installed on each user terminal 2. Hereinafter, this application software will also be referred to as "Checkin Manager." For ease of explanation, three users will be introduced from among the plurality of users, and the three users will be referred to as a first user, a second user, and a third user, respectively. The name of the first user will be referred to as "Name A," the name of the second user will be referred to as "Name B," and the name of the third user will be referred to as "Name C." The user terminal 2 carried by the first user will be referred to as a first user terminal 2A, the user terminal 2 carried by the second user will be referred to as a second user terminal 2B, and the user terminal 2 carried by the third user will be referred to as a third user terminal 2C. Each user has different user identification information (hereinafter, also referred to as a user ID). In the following description, the user ID of the first user is "A1", the user ID of the second user is "A2", and the user ID of the third user is "A3".

[0016] As shown in FIG. 1, the seat reservation system 100 includes a processing unit 14, a communication unit 15, and a storage unit 17.

[0017] The processing unit 14 generates image data for a reservation reception image G1 (see FIG. 3) in which multiple icons 7 (see FIG. 3) indicating the availability of multiple seats 6 are superimposed on an office map image 5 (see FIG. 2). The office map image 5 is an image that reflects the layout of multiple seats in a free-address office. In other words, the map image 5 is an image of an office in which the positions of each of the multiple seats 6 are determined in the office layout. The multiple seats 6 in the office map image 5 correspond one-to-one to the multiple seats in the free-address office. In the example of FIG. 3, the icon 7 for an unused seat 6 among the multiple seats 6 is an icon with the word "vacant" written in a circle, and the icon 7 for a seat 6 occupied by a user is an icon with an image (user's facial image) indicating the user's attributes (face) displayed in a circle and the user's name displayed below the user's facial image. The multiple seats 6 may include, for example, seats for work, seats for breaks (sofas), seats in private booths dedicated to online meetings, seats in a conference room, etc. Regarding seats in a conference room, there are two or more seats in one conference room, and in this embodiment, one icon 7 is associated with each conference room. The office map image 5 can be generated using, for example, BIM (Building Information Modeling) data, but it may also be generated without using BIM data. In the seat reservation system 100, different seat identification information (hereinafter also referred to as seat ID) is set for each seat 6. The seat ID of each of the multiple seats 6 is stored in the memory unit 17.

[0018] The communication unit 15 transmits image data generated by the processing unit 14 to the user terminal 2 and receives multiple pieces of information related to the user's initiation of a seat use procedure or seat reservation procedure from the user terminal 2 displaying the reservation acceptance image G1. The communication unit 15 can transmit the image data generated by the processing unit 14 to all user terminals 2. The storage unit 17 stores the user ID and the usage time (date and time) of the seat 6 currently being used by the user (the seat ID of the seat 6 for which the user selected the icon 7 and performed the check-in operation) or the usage time (date and time) of the reserved seat 6 (the seat ID of the seat 6 reserved by the user) in association with each other (see FIG. 4). "The user performed a check-in operation" means that the user performed a predetermined input operation on the operation unit 23 of the user terminal 2 when starting to use the seat 6. In the seat reservation system 100, when the user finishes using the seat 6 currently being used and performs a check-out operation on the user terminal 2, the icon 7 corresponding to the seat 6 is changed to the icon 7 of an unused seat 6, and the data linking the user ID, seat ID, and usage time is deleted from the storage unit 17. Furthermore, the storage unit 17 stores the seat ID, the usage time of the seat 6, the state of the seat 6, and the name of the user in association with each other (see FIG. 5).

[0019] A user can use the checked-in seat 6 until checking out, but is not required to be seated in the seat 6; for example, the user may place their luggage on the seat 6 and occupy it while using another seat 6 or going out to eat, etc.

[0020] The multiple pieces of information received by the communication unit 15 include, for example, a user ID, information on one icon 7 (hereinafter also referred to as the selected icon 7) selected from the multiple icons 7 in the reservation reception image G1, and time information on the usage time (from the start time of usage to the end time of usage) of the seat 6 corresponding to one selected icon 7 among the multiple seats 6.

[0021] When the total number of seats 6 currently being used by the user and the total number of seats 6 reserved by the user, which are stored in the memory unit 17, is equal to or less than an allowable number (for example, 2), the processing unit 14 generates image data of an input image G2 (see FIG. 6) that accepts input from the user to proceed with the seat use procedure or seat reservation procedure, and transmits the image data from the communication unit 15 to the user terminal 2. When the total number is greater than the allowable number, the processing unit 14 generates image data of a notification image G4 (see FIG. 10) that notifies the user that continuation of the seat use procedure or seat reservation procedure is not permitted, and transmits the image data from the communication unit 15 to the user terminal 2.

[0022] The input image G2 includes a map image 5, a location display field 8 for the seat 6 corresponding to the icon 7 selected by the user, a display field 9 for the start and end times of the seat 6's usage time, and an OK button 10. The usage time of the seat 6 can be changed by the user of the user terminal 2. As shown in FIG. 6, in the input image G2, the circle of the icon 7 selected by the user (selected icon 7) on the user terminal 2 is displayed with a thicker line than the circles of the other icons 7. However, the icon 7 may be displayed with a different color, or a part of the icon 7 (for example, a circle) may be displayed as a flashing icon. In the input image G2 of FIG. 6, the user can also change the usage start time and usage end time of the usage time. When the user selects (clicks) the OK button 10 in the input image G2 of FIG. 6, check-in is performed. The user's schedule stored in the user terminal 2 is updated and displayed on the display unit 24 of the user terminal 2 (see FIG. 7), and notification information (check-in information) of the start of usage of the seat 6 is transmitted from the user terminal 2.

[0023] In the seat reservation system 100, the processing unit 14 performs a first process and a second process when the communication unit 15 receives notification information from the user terminal 2 displaying the input image G2 that a seat 6 corresponding to one of the selection icons 7 has begun to be used. The first process is a process of generating image data of a reservation acceptance image G1 (see FIG. 8 ) in which one of the selection icons 7 has been replaced with an icon 7 indicating the attributes of the user of the user terminal 2, and transmitting the image data from the communication unit 15 to the user terminal 2. The second process is a process of rewriting the contents of the storage unit 17 based on the notification information. Note that FIG. 8 illustrates the reservation acceptance image G1 in a case where a first user with a name A, a second user with a name B, and a third user with a name C have each checked in to one seat 6. In contrast, FIG. 9 illustrates the reservation acceptance image G1 in a case where a first user with a name A and a second user with a name B have each checked in to one seat 6, and a third user with a name C has checked in to two seats 6.

[0024] Furthermore, when the processing unit 14 receives information indicating an intention to continue the seat usage procedure or seat reservation procedure from the user terminal 2 that has displayed the notification image G4, it generates image data of a display image G6 (see FIG. 11) for performing a procedure to terminate usage of a seat 6 currently being used by the user or a procedure to cancel a seat 6 that the user has reserved so that the total number is equal to or less than the allowable number, and causes the communication unit 15 to transmit the image data to the user terminal 2. When the processing unit 14 receives instruction information indicating a procedure to terminate usage or a procedure to cancel from the user terminal 2 that has displayed the display image G6, it rewrites the contents stored in the memory unit 17 based on the instruction information.

[0025] Moreover, the processing unit 14 generates image data of the input image G2 only if the seat 6 desired by the user is not already reserved during the available time of the seat 6.

[0046] Below, the operation of the user terminal 2 in the seat reservation system 100 will be explained based on the flowchart in Fig. 13, and the operation of the server 1 will be explained based on the flowchart in Fig. 14. Note that the flowchart in Fig. 13 is a flowchart for explaining an example of the operation of the third user terminal 2C carried by the third user when the allowable number is 2, but the operation examples of the other user terminals 2 are similar. Also, the flowchart in Fig. 14 is a flowchart for explaining an example of the operation of the server 1 when the third user operates the third user terminal 2C when the allowable number is 2, but the operation is similar when another user operates the user terminal 2 carried by that user.

[0047] When the third user starts Checkin Manager and logs in by entering his / her user ID and password, a home image is displayed on the display unit 24 of the third user terminal 2C. When the third user performs an operation to select "Floor Map" from "Home," "Floor Map," and "Logout" on the home image of the third user terminal 2C, for example, a reservation acceptance image G1 shown in FIG. 3 is displayed on the display unit 24.

[0048] When one of the icons 7 in the reservation acceptance image G1, namely, an “available” icon 7 (assuming the seat ID of the seat 6 corresponding to this icon 7 is “01”), is selected (step S1), an input image G2, for example, as shown in FIG. 6, is displayed (step S2). The input image G2 includes a dialog box 69 displaying the location of the seat 6 with seat ID=01, the usage time of the seat 6 with seat ID=01, and an OK button 10 for checking in or reserving the seat 6 with seat ID=01. In the example of FIG. 6, the location of the seat 6 with seat ID=01 is “C-01.” The usage time includes a usage start time and a usage end time. For example, the current time is displayed as the default for the usage start time, and a predetermined time (e.g., three hours) after the current time is displayed as the default for the usage end time. The third user can change the usage start time and usage end time by operating the operation unit 16 depending on whether they want to check in to the seat 6 or reserve the seat 6, the desired usage time of the seat 6, etc.

[0049] After step S2, when the third user operates the operation unit 16 to click the OK button 10, the user terminal 2 accepts the input for check-in or reservation of seat 6 with seat ID=01, transmits the third user's user ID, seat ID=01, use start time, use end time, etc. to the server 1, and displays a home image with the third user's schedule updated on the display unit 24 (step S3). For example, if the third user checks in or reserves seat 6 with seat ID=01 with the use start time set to the current time, a home image with the third user's schedule updated is displayed as shown in FIG. 7. The home image shown in FIG. 7 is an example of a check-in. When the third user clicks "Floor Map" on the home image, a reservation acceptance image G1 (see FIG. 8) is displayed in which the icon 7 corresponding to seat 6 with seat ID=01 has been changed to an icon 7 displaying the third user's face image and the third user's name C. Note that when "Floor Map" is clicked on the display unit 24 of the user terminal 2, an image including a map image 5 of the floor where the user of the user terminal 2 works is displayed.

[0050] With the reservation acceptance image G1 of FIG. 8 displayed, when the icon 7 corresponding to the seat 6 with seat ID=04 is selected (step S4), an input image similar to the input image G2 shown in FIG. 6 is displayed (step S5).

[0051] The input image displayed in step S5 includes a dialog box displaying the location of seat 6 with seat ID=04 ("C-04"), the usage time of seat 6 with seat ID=04, and an OK button 10 (see Figure 6) for checking in or reserving seat 6 with seat ID=04.

[0052] After step S5, when the third user operates the operation unit 16 to click the OK button, the user terminal 2 accepts the check-in input for seat 6 with seat ID=04, transmits the third user's user ID, seat ID=04, start time of use, end time of use, etc. to the server 1, and displays a home image with the third user's schedule updated (step S6). In this embodiment, the location of seat 6 with seat ID=04 is "C-04." If the third user has checked in in step S6, when the third user clicks "Floor Map" on the home image, a reservation acceptance image G1 (see FIG. 9) is displayed in which the icon 7 corresponding to seat 6 with seat ID=04 has been changed to an icon 7 displaying the third user's face image and the third user's name C.

[0053] With the reservation acceptance image G1 of FIG. 9 displayed, when the icon 7 corresponding to the seat 6 with seat ID=03 is selected (step S7), step S8 is carried out.

[0054] In step S8, a notification image G4 indicating that the check-in button 60 cannot be operated is displayed, as shown in FIG. 10. The notification image G4 is an image notifying the user that the seat usage procedure or seat reservation procedure is not permitted to continue. When the third user selects "Home," a display image G6 is displayed, as shown in FIG. 11, including a schedule showing the usage times of the locations of the two seats 6 (C-01 and C-04 in the example of FIG. 11) already checked in and a check-out button 61. The display image G6 is an image for completing the procedure to terminate the usage of the seats 6 currently being used by the user or canceling the seats 6 reserved by the user so that the total number is equal to or less than the allowable number. When the third user clicks the check-out button 61 on the display image G6 by operating the operation unit 23, a check-out image G7 including a check-out dialog box 70 is displayed (step S8), as shown in FIG. 12. The dialog box 70 allows the third user to select which of the two seats 6 currently being used by the third user to check out. When the third user selects a seat 6 to be checked out and clicks the checkout button 73 in the dialog box 70, a checkout input for the selected seat 6 (e.g., seat 6 with seat ID = 01) is accepted (step S9), and checkout for that seat 6 is performed. FIG. 12 shows a case in which seat 6 with location "C-01" is selected from seat 6 with location "C-01" (seat 6 with seat ID = 01) and seat 6 with location "C-04" (seat 6 with seat ID = 04). In this embodiment, when the checkout button 73 is clicked, instruction information indicating a usage termination procedure (checkout) is sent from the user terminal 2 to the server 1. Note that in this embodiment, when the cancel button 74 in the dialog box 70 is clicked, instruction information indicating a cancellation procedure is sent from the user terminal 2 to the server 1.

[0055] When check-out of one of the two seats 6 is completed, check-in or reservation of the seat 6 with seat ID=03 is performed (step S10).

[0056] After check-in or reservation of seat 6 with seat ID=03 is completed in step S10, the end time of use of seat 6 with seat ID=03 ends, and then, for example, when the third user logs out of Check-in Manager, use of the seat reservation system 100 by the third user terminal 2C ends.

[0057] The processing unit 14 receives information regarding check-in or reservation input from the third user terminal 2C of the third user (step S21), and then determines whether the total number of seats checked in by the third user at the same time and the number of seats reserved by the third user is less than or equal to the allowable number (2 in this embodiment) (step S22).

[0058] If the total number is equal to or less than the allowable number in step S22, the processing unit 14 stores the usage time related to the check-in or reservation in the storage unit 17 (step S23), changes the display of the icon 7 on the map image 5 (floor map) to an icon 7 representing the face image and name C of the third user (step S24), and stores the check-in data of the third user (information related to check-in) in the storage unit 17 (step S25). The check-in data of the third user includes the user ID of the third user, the seat ID of the seat 6 where the user has checked in, and the usage time (the start time and end time of usage).

[0059] If there is a check-in or reservation input from the third user terminal 2C of the third user after step S25 (step S26: Yes), the processing unit 14 returns to step S22. Also, if there is no check-in or reservation input from the third user terminal 2C of the third user after step S25 (step S26: No), the processing unit 14 receives information related to check-out from the third user terminal 2C of the third user (step S27) and changes the data in the second database that records the seat data as shown in Fig. 5 (step S28). In step S28, for example, the check-in or reservation usage time and the name C of the third user for seat 6 with seat ID = 01 are deleted.

[0060] After step S28, the processing unit 14 changes the data in the first database in which the check-in data as shown in Fig. 4 is recorded in the storage unit 17 (step S29). In step S29, the use of seat 6 with seat ID = 01 by the third user and the usage time of seat 6 with seat ID = 01 are deleted.

[0061] After step S29, the processing unit 14 generates image data of a reservation acceptance image in which the icon 7 corresponding to seat ID=01 is changed to an "vacant" icon 7, and causes the communication unit 15 to transmit the image data to all user terminals 2 that request the floor map (step S30). Therefore, when the floor map is clicked on the home image of the third user terminal 2C, the communication unit 15 causes the image data of the reservation acceptance image to be transmitted to the third user terminal 2C of the third user.

[0062] If the total number is greater than the allowable number in step S22 (step S22: No), the processing unit 14 sends image data of the checkout image G7 to the third user terminal 2C of the third user and displays the checkout image G7 on the display unit 24 of the third user terminal 2C (step S31).

[0063] After step S31, the processing unit 14 receives information related to check-out (check-out input) from the third user terminal 2C of the third user (step S32), and then transmits image data of the newly created reservation acceptance image G1 (i.e., an image in which the seat 6 has been changed to show that it is check-in or available for reservation) to display on the display unit 24 of the third user terminal 2C (step S33).

[0064] After step S33, the processing unit 14 changes the data in the second database that records the seat data as shown in Fig. 5 (step S34). In step S34, for example, the check-in or reservation usage time and the name C of the third user for seat 6 with seat ID = 01 are deleted.

[0065] After step S34, the processing unit 14 changes the data in the first database in which the check-in data shown in Fig. 4 is recorded in the memory unit 17 (step S35), and returns to step S21. In step S35, the information that the third user will use seat 6 with seat ID = 01 and the usage time of seat 6 with seat ID = 01 are deleted.

[0071] (Variation) The above-described embodiment is merely one of various embodiments of the present disclosure. The above-described embodiment can be modified in various ways depending on the design, etc., as long as the object of the present disclosure can be achieved.

[0072] For example, the seat reservation system 100 described in the embodiment includes a plurality of user terminals 2, but may not include a plurality of user terminals 2.

[0073] The user terminal 2 is not limited to a notebook personal computer, and may be, for example, a smartphone as shown in FIGS. 16 and 17. In this case, the display unit 24 is equipped with a touch panel including a display device such as a liquid crystal display or an organic EL (Electro Luminescence) display and a touchpad, and functions as a GUI (Graphical User Interface). That is, the user terminal 2 outputs a reservation acceptance image G1 and the like to the display unit 24 and accepts information input from the touchpad. Various images are displayed on the display unit 24 as needed.

[0074] Fig. 16 shows a reservation acceptance image G1 having the same function as Fig. 3 displayed on the display unit 24 of the user terminal 2. Fig. 17 shows an input image G2 having the same function as Fig. 6 displayed on the display unit 24 of the user terminal 2. Since the screen of a smartphone is smaller than the screen of a notebook personal computer, the map image 5 is not displayed in the input image G2 in Fig. 17, but the map image 5 may also be displayed.

[0075] Furthermore, the user attributes displayed on the icon 7 are not limited to both the user's face image and name, but may be, for example, at least one of the user's face image and name, or may be a combination of the user's avatar image and the user's name.

[0076] The seat reservation system 100 may also be configured so that when the time for using the seat 6 that the user has checked in for has expired, the user is automatically checked out of the seat 6.
